Yemen - Import of Combine Harvester-Threshers
Since 2014, Yemen Import of Combine Harvester-Threshers fell by 61.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 137 among other countries in Import of Combine Harvester-Threshers with $860. Yemen is overtaken by Kuwait, which was number 136 with $1,031.21 and is followed by Antigua and Barbuda with $609.45. Canada topped the ranking with $575,805,440 in 2019, that is a fall of 21.5% versus 2018. Ukraine, France and Australia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Lesotho witnessed the best average annual growth at +221.9% per year, while Panama recorded the worst performance at -68.1% per year.
